Premier League fixtures 2015/16: Manchester United host Tottenham and Arsenal face West Ham on opening weekend

Tottenham face a tough away trip to Old Trafford on the opening weekend of the new season.

Mauricio Pochettino's side will take on a Manchester United side which is likely to be bolstered by a host of big-money summer signings, one of whom could be Spurs skipper Hugo Lloris.

The Premier League fixtures announced today also reveal that Slaven Bilic's first game coaching in the Premier League will be away to FA Cup winners Arsenal.

The Croatian faces the daunting task of reversing a ten game losing streak against Arsene Wenger's side.

Premier League newcomers Watford are away to Everton, giving new Hornets boss Quique Sanchez Flores a chance to test his credentials against his countryman Roberto Martinez.

Crystal Palace are away to promoted Norwich on the first weekend.

The first weekend's fixtures will be on the 8th, 9th and 10th of August.
